# KwaZulu-Natal Hawks Unit Commander Gavin Jacob has denied any involvement in the theft of drugs linked to the 541-kilogram cocaine seizure in Port Shepstone. Testifying before the Madlanga Commission, Jacob said he was unaware of security problems at the building before the incident was reported in November 2021. # Atletiek: Brittanje se beheerliggaam is met 7,67-miljoen-rand beboet vir die dood van die Paralimpiese gewigstoot-atleet Abdullah Hayayei. Die 36-jarige is dood nadat ‘n metaalgooihok op sy kop geval het tydens oefening in Londen in 2017. Hy was besig met voorbereiding vir die Wêreld-Para-atletiekkampioenskap.
